From: Christian Heller Date: Sun, 23 Mar 2025 11:39:29 +0000 (+0100) Subject: Fix formatting/readability of add_button code. X-Git-Url: https://plomlompom.com/repos/%7B%7B%20web_path%20%7D%7D/static/%7B%7Bprefix%7D%7D/templates?a=commitdiff_plain;h=c895e27a0a1a6a5bb7ca884c8bff0b544eeda92c;p=ledgplom Fix formatting/readability of add_button code. --- diff --git a/src/templates/edit_structured.tmpl b/src/templates/edit_structured.tmpl index 676f49a..0ca2416 100644 --- a/src/templates/edit_structured.tmpl +++ b/src/templates/edit_structured.tmpl @@ -25,22 +25,22 @@ function update_form() { // basic helpers function add_button(parent_td, label, disabled, onclick) { // add button to td to run onclick (after updating dat_lines from inputs, - // and followed by calling taint and update_form + // and followed by calling taint and update_form) const btn = document.createElement("button"); parent_td.appendChild(btn); btn.textContent = label; btn.type = "button"; // otherwise will act as form submit btn.disabled = disabled; btn.onclick = function() { - let n_lines_jumped = 0; + let n_rows_jumped = 0; // to ignore table rows not representing dat_lines for (let i = 0; i < table.rows.length; i++) { const row = table.rows[i]; if (row.classList.contains('warning')) { - n_lines_jumped++; + n_rows_jumped++; continue; }; for (const input of table.rows[i].querySelectorAll('td input')) { - const line_to_update = dat_lines[i - n_lines_jumped]; + const line_to_update = dat_lines[i - n_rows_jumped]; if (input.name.endsWith('comment')) { line_to_update.comment = input.value; } else if (input.name.endsWith('error')) { @@ -58,9 +58,9 @@ function update_form() { } } } - onclick(); - taint(); - update_form(); + onclick(); + taint(); + update_form(); }; } function add_td(tr, colspan=1) {